package com.android.cts.managedprofile;
import android.app.Activity;
import android.content.ComponentName;
import android.content.pm.PackageManager;
import android.os.Bundle;
import android.os.Process;
import android.util.Log;
/**
* Class that disables a given component for the user it's running in.
*/
public class ComponentDisablingActivity extends Activity {
private static final String TAG = ComponentDisablingActivity.class.getName();
public static final String EXTRA_PACKAGE = "extra-package";
public static final String EXTRA_CLASS_NAME = "extra-class-name";
@Override
public void onCreate(Bundle savedInstanceState) {
super.onCreate(savedInstanceState);
String extraClassName = getIntent().getStringExtra(EXTRA_CLASS_NAME);
String extraPackage = getIntent().getStringExtra(EXTRA_PACKAGE);
Log.i(TAG, "Disabling: " + extraPackage + "/" + extraClassName + " for user "
+ Process.myUserHandle());
PackageManager packageManager = getPackageManager();
packageManager.setComponentEnabledSetting(new ComponentName(extraPackage, extraClassName),
PackageManager.COMPONENT_ENABLED_STATE_DISABLED,
PackageManager.DONT_KILL_APP);
}
}
